The Certified Specialist Programme in Senior Mental Wellness provides comprehensive training in geriatric mental health. Participants will gain a deep understanding of the unique mental health challenges faced by older adults, equipping them with the necessary skills for effective intervention and support.
Learning outcomes include mastering assessment techniques for common mental health conditions in seniors, developing tailored intervention strategies, and understanding the complexities of age-related cognitive decline, including dementia care. The programme also covers ethical considerations and legal frameworks relevant to geriatric mental health practice.
The programme's duration is typically six months, delivered through a blend of online modules, interactive workshops, and practical case studies. This flexible approach allows professionals to integrate their learning with their existing commitments.
This Certified Specialist Programme in Senior Mental Wellness is highly relevant to various healthcare professionals, including nurses, social workers, psychologists, and caregivers.
